Do not be so quick to pass judgement, there are several options in the 
power output path.

Remove the KAT1 - and do not forget to change the RF source jumper to 
the K1 position.
After doing that, what is the power output on each band?  If it is 5 
watts or greater (usually 6 to 7 watts), then the K1 is working fine and 
the remaining problems will be found in the KAT1 or your antenna system.
